A compelling collection of 20 first-person accounts revealing the challenges and solutions of peacebuilders working in conflict zones worldwide.

With the increasing number of destructive wars and deadly international conflicts, peacebuilding and peacekeeping have become global priorities. This book helps us understand the challenges for those involved in conflict resolution across a range of organizations and professions.

At the Heart of Conflict: Talking Resolution offers 20 first-person accounts of the differing approaches taken in international conflicts and peace processes as well as the solutions found by those in jobs on the ground.

This book is an essential read for those studying conflict resolution, international relations, or working in the field, looking to know more about the lived experiences of UN officials, translators, ambassadors, NGOs and military personnel.

Kezie-Nwoha, Helen: - Helen Kezie-Nwoha is a feminist peace activist and a women human rights defender from Nigeria. She is currently the Executive Director at The Women's International Peace Centre, formerly Isis Women's International Cross Cultural Exchange (Isis-WICCE). The Centre is a feminist organisation that focus on promoting women's rights in conflict and post conflict settings.
